WebAug 9, 2024 · China’s First Self-Constructed Railway. The first railway that was built by Chinese people is Tangxu Railway, also known as Kaiping Colliery Tramway. Opened in 1881, this railway ran from Tangshan to Xugezhuang in Hebei Province. This 9.7-kilometer-long railway used standard gauge of 1,435 millimeters, was built for the purposes of coal ... WebFeb 16, 2024 · The China-Thailand railway, an important part of the trans-Asian railway network, will be Thailand's first standard-gauge railway. When completed, the line will carry trains from Bangkok to the border town of Nong Kai, where a new bridge will connect it with the China-Laos railway, making it possible to travel by train from Bangkok, through ...
